5.34 UNDERTORQUE DETECTION
For undertorque detection during accel or decel, set to " 3 " or " 4 ".
For continuous operation after undertorque detection, set to " 1 " or " 3 ". During detection, the Digital Operator
displays and " UL3 " alarm (blinking).
To stop the drive at an undertorque detection fault, set to " 2 " or " 4 ". At detection, the Digital Operator displays an
" UL3 " fault.
To output an undertorque detection signal, set output terminal function selection (n057, n058 or n059 ) to
" 8 " or " 9 ".
B.
n118 : Undertorque Detection Level
This is the reference point for determining that an undertorque condition exists. Set as a percent of Drive rated
current or as a percent of motor rated torque.
C.
n119 : Undertorque Detection Time
Determines how long an undertorque condition must exist before another event will occur, e.g. coast to stop,
multi-function output change of state, or UL3 warning or fault display.
